In Episode 37 of Altered States Unplugged, we're having an honest conversation about what helped us quit drinking and what early sobriety actually looked like for us.
For a long time, alcohol was how we relaxed, celebrated, took the edge off, and shut our brains off after a hard day. Eventually, we had to admit that the short-term relief was coming with a bigger cost: worse sleep, more anxiety, less energy, and feeling less like ourselves.
We share the practical things that helped us most, including changing our routines, understanding our triggers, moving through cravings, protecting our sleep, and finding healthier ways to relax and shift our state.
This isn't about labels, shame, or telling anyone what they should do. It's simply our story, what worked for us, and what we wish we had known sooner.
If you've ever wondered whether alcohol is still serving you, this episode is for you.
